Fusion Proteins



New findings reported from J. Chen and co-authors describe advances in fusion proteins



September 15th, 2008

According to recent research from the United States, "Reciprocal chromosomal translocations at the MLL gene locus result in expression of novel fusion proteins, such as MLL-ENL, associated with leukemia. The three PHD finger cassette, one of the highly conserved domains in AILL, is absent in all fusion proteins."

"This domain has been shown to interact with Cyp33, a cyclophilin which enhances the recruitment of histone deacetylases (HDAC) to the NILL repression domain and mediates HOX gene repression.
